
Fans look forward to a strong box office clash, and with Dhurandhar releasing on 5th December, the stage is set. Tere Ishk Mein, starring Dhanush and Kriti Sanon, released on 28th November and has already turned into a surprise hit.
In five days, Tere Ishk Mein collected over 65 crores, and the makers want to continue shows without major reduction. Distributor Anil Thadani (AA Films) has requested solid showcasing for week two. Single screens are open to giving one show to Tere Ishk Mein and the rest to Dhurandhar.
However, Jio Studios has declined to share even one show, as the Dhurandhar team demands full single-screen dominance for the first week. The tussle has now reached multiplex chains. AA Films asked for fixed show counts, while Dhurandhar wants maximum screens everywhere.
Negotiations continue, and both sides wait for a solution. Due to this standoff, advance bookings for Dhurandhar are not fully open yet. Bookings are expected to clear by Thursday noon once terms settle between both teams.
Some say Dhurandhar appears insecure, while others insist they want fair visibility for a new release. With rising ticket prices, most viewers end up picking one film over two. The question now is whether Tere Ishk Mein slows Dhurandhar at the box office.
